As used in this article:

(a)“Local agency” means county, city, city and county, including a chartered city or county, a community college district, or other public agency or corporation in this state.
(b)“Treasurer” means treasurer of the local agency.
(c)“Depository” means a state or national bank, savings association or federal association, a state or federal credit union, or a federally insured industrial loan company, in this state in which the moneys of a local agency are deposited.
